Study of ΛΛ dynamics and ground state structure of low and medium mass double Λ hypernuclei

Description

We critically review the dynamics by examining ΛΛ and Λ-nucleon phenomenological potentials in the study of the bound state properties of double-Λ hypernuclei 6ΛHe, 10ΛBe, 14ΛΛC, 18ΛΛO, 22 ΛΛNe, 26ΛΛMg, 30ΛΛSi, 34ΛΛS, 38ΛΛAr, 42ΛΛCa, 46ΛΛTi, 50ΛΛCr, 54ΛΛFe, 58ΛΛNi, 62ΛΛZn, 66ΛΛGe, 70ΛΛSe, 74ΛΛKr, 82ΛΛZr, 86ΛΛMo, 90ΛΛRu, 94ΛΛPd, 98ΛΛCd, 102ΛΛSn in the frame work of (core+Λ+Λ) three body model. An effective ΛN potential is obtained by folding the phenomenological ΛN potential into the density distribution of the core nuclei. The former two cases (i.e. 6ΛΛHe and 10ΛΛBe) are revisited to justify the correctness of the present potential model. Assuming the same potential model we predicted some of the structural properties of heavier doubly Λ-hypernuclei. The hyperspherical harmonics expansion method, which is an essentially exact method has been employed for the three body system. A convergence in binding energy up to 0.15% for Kmax = 20 has been achieved. In our calculation we have made no approximation in restricting the allowed l-values of the interacting pairs. (author)
